Foundation Overview
Based in Clinton Twp, MI, Floyd B & Helen M Thormann Foundation Inc has awarded 75 grants totaling $114,540 to organizations in Michigan, Tennessee and 3 other states across the US. Individual grants range from $200 to $3,500, with a median award of $1,000.

Geographic Focus
73% of all grants are concentrated in Michigan, demonstrating highly focused geographic giving. This foundation prioritizes deep community impact in its primary service area. Within Michigan, funding concentrates in Detroit (31%), Clinton Twp (18%), Sterling Heights (7%).

Form 990-PF Research Tips
-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
-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
-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
-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
